Site work for a development in La Crosse, Wisconsin. Completed plans call for site work for a development.

Major components of the work include: Phase IX Module 1 Liner Construction consisting of a composite liner system, approximately 4.8 acres, with an HDPE geomembrane and a 4-foot compacted clay layer; perimeter berm and ditch grading; leachate collection drainage layer with side slope riser, headwell, and Schedule 80 PVC leachate collection piping; and construction of leachate transfer and loadout system. C-3B Final Closure Construction includes an approximate 4.1-acre composite liner system comprised of two feet of compacted clay and an LLDPE geomembrane overlain with a synthetic geo-composite drainage layer; placement of a 2.5-foot general soils rooting zone layer overlain with a 6-inch layer of vegetated soils including tree plantings; installation of downslope drainage piping and a flow diversion structure; installation of three landfill gas extraction wells in 36-inch diameter boreholes, interconnecting gas header piping, and valves. Phase IX Module 1 Liner Construction of a composite liner system, including an approximate 4.8-acre composite liner consisting of an HDPE geomembrane and a 4-foot compacted clay layer. Current subbase grades are near proposed subbase grades but will need additional excavation and shaping for construction of sump, sideslope riser trench, and leachate collection trench. Completed subbase will need survey verification prior to placement of clay liner. Installation of HDPE leachate collection piping, gravel leachate collection drainage layer, side slope riser, and headwells. Aggregate to be used for leachate drainage layer and trench will be stockpiled on the pad south of the closed ash monofill site as noted on Plan Sheet G4. Stockpiling of aggregate materials near Phase IX Module 1 will need to be coordinated with Owner and Engineer to ensure no disruption to landfill traffic. Installation of leachate transfer system: Construction of sideslope pump house structure Construction of dual contained transfer piping and manholes for connection to existing transfer infrastructure. Modification to the existing LD-3 manhole will require construction of new piping within LD-3 and coring of existing structure for pipe connection. New pipe and core hole must be fitted with a water tight gasket to ensure no liquid can enter or exit the manhole through the annular space created by the connection. Construction of lift station and loadout pad. Lift station includes a 4,500 gallon fiberglass wet well insert. Integrator: Installation of SCADA and control panel system for pump control at sideslope riser pump house and lift station is sole source. Mark Antczak 612.419.1565 mantczak@sehinc.com C-3B Closure Construction Construction of an approximate 4.1-acre composite liner system comprised of two feet of compacted clay and an LLDPE geomembrane overlain with a synthetic geo-composite drainage layer. Ash wastes from the MSW Ash Overlay at the top of the landfill will be used to provide final waste grading of areas below final waste elevations. Once ash waste is placed for grading, no other wastes may be placed above ash. Placement of a 2.5-foot general soils rooting zone layer overlain with a 6-inch layer of vegetated topsoil and trees. Installation of three landfill gas extraction wells in 36-inch diameter boreholes, interconnecting gas header piping, and valves. a. Moisture sampling during drilling of well boreholes will be conducted by the Owner as part of the site's RD&D plan. Coordinate with Owner and Engineer for timing of borehole drilling. Provide 72 hours notice. Installation of downslope drainage piping and an energy dissipation stilling well structure. Stormwater Ditch grading and installation of stormwater culverts. Additional stormwater grading may be required along the toe of the western portion of C 3B. Provide drainage to ensure flow from stilling well structure to catch basin at southwest corner of Phase IX Module 1.
